How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Belle Haven?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Belle Haven Studio Apartments | $1,069 | $799 | $1,684 |
Belle Haven 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,448 | $808 | $2,294 |
Belle Haven 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,610 | $893 | $2,952 |
Belle Haven 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,911 | $860 | $3,390 |
Belle Haven 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,871 | $1,790 | $1,970 |

Getting Around Belle Haven, VA
Walk Score®
9 / 100
Car-Dependent
Almost all errands require a car
Bike Score®
31 / 100
Somewhat Bikeable
Minimal bike infrastructure
